Exception at first REPLY with signed message

1. Start Mozilla Mail client
2. Reply to a mail, my own mail will be signed
3. send the mail: Mozilla reyuests the master password
4. entering the master password and pressing return: => exception, Mozilla goes down
Work around:
1. send a signed message, Mozilla requests the master password
2. entering it, message will be sent
3. reply to above metioned message will now work
